Your Greatest Victory

Your greatest victory Was my worst defeat When you walked the high road I stumbled down the low road When you gained it all I truly lost everything You became whole And I slowly fell to pieces You have nothing but time But time for me has frozen I was just a small chapter to you But to me you're several novels You filled my days with warm rays of light But now I stand forever cast in darkness Your eyes made me feel real But now I feel plastic and fake Our time together was pleasurable But the memories are painful Wherever you walk the sun shines Wherever I walk the rain follows Your greatest victory Was my worst defeat Because you got to walk away While I could only stand and watch
